I want to add an extra thumbnail feature to mediatomb for my PS3 but it requires ffmpegthumbnailer. Well, I thought I've installed all necessary requirements for ffmpegthumbnailer but when I start the configure-script it stops with the message:
...
checking jpeglib.h usability... yes
checking jpeglib.h presence... yes
checking for jpeglib.h... yes
checking for pkg-config... /usr/bin/pkg-config
checking pkg-config is at least version 0.9.0... yes
checking for FFMPEG... no
configure: error: +Could not find ffmpeg. Please update PKG_CONFIG_PATH to point at location of ffmpeg pkgconfig files directory.
ffmpeg ist installed so what does this message mean?
I've add the configure.log here.
System: Debian Etch 2.6.26

You have to install the development ffmpeg files (headers and libraries). In Debian these are splitted in 4 different packages: libavutil-dev, libavcodec-dev, libswscale-dev and libavformat-dev. You can see these requirements also in the config.log:
Code:
configure:16027: $? = 1
No package 'libavutil' found
No package 'libavformat' found
No package 'libavcodec' found
No package 'libswscale' found
configure:16054: result: no
configure:16056: error: +Could not find ffmpeg. Please update
PKG_CONFIG_PATH to point at location of ffmpeg pkgconfig files directory.
